Female Hormone Replacement Therapy

Studies show that around 43% of women have reported that hormonal imbalances have affected their overall health

If you're experiencing the following, it's likely due to hormonal imbalance:

  • Irregular Menstrual Cycles:

Hormonal fluctuations can affect the menstrual cycle, leading to irregular periods, heavy or light bleeding, or missed periods. Changes in the length and intensity of menstrual cycles may indicate a hormonal imbalance.

  • Changes in Mood:

Hormones influence neurotransmitters in the brain, and an imbalance can result in mood swings, irritability, anxiety, or even depression. Estrogen and progesterone levels, in particular, can impact mood and emotional well-being.

  • Weight Fluctuations:

Hormonal imbalances can contribute to weight gain or difficulty losing weight. Insulin resistance and thyroid dysfunction are common hormonal factors associated with weight changes.

  • Fatigue:

Disruptions in thyroid hormones and adrenal function can lead to chronic fatigue and low energy levels.

  • Sleep Disturbances:

Changes in estrogen and progesterone levels can impact sleep patterns, leading to insomnia or disrupted sleep.

  • Changes in Skin and Hair:

Hormonal fluctuations can impact skin health, leading to acne, dryness, or increased sensitivity. Changes in hair texture, thickness, or even hair loss may also be signs of hormonal imbalance.

  • Libido Changes:

Imbalances may lead to a decrease or increase in libido, affecting a woman's sexual health.

  • Digestive Issues:

Hormonal imbalances can impact the digestive system, leading to symptoms such as bloating, constipation, or diarrhea. Insulin resistance, in particular, can contribute to digestive problems.

  • Headaches and Migraines:

Fluctuations in estrogen levels, especially during the menstrual cycle, can trigger headaches and migraines in some women.

  • Joint Pain:

Changes in hormone levels, particularly during menopause, can contribute to joint pain and stiffness.

Male Hormone Replacement Therapy

Reports show that 2 in every 100 men experience low testosterone levels. This hormonal imbalance can happen due to a range of reasons, including poor sleep habits, chronic stress, unhealthy diet, or other environmental impacts.

Signs of hormonal imbalances in men can include:

  • Low Libido:

A decrease in sex drive can be a sign of imbalanced hormones, particularly low testosterone levels.

  • Difficulty Achieving or Maintaining Erections:

Testosterone is essential for maintaining sexual function, and a hormonal imbalance may result in erectile dysfunction.

  • Increased Body Fat:

A decrease in testosterone levels may lead to an increase in body fat, especially around the abdomen.

  • Persistent Fatigue:

Hormonal imbalances, including low testosterone, can result in persistent fatigue and low energy levels.

  • Mood Changes:

Hormonal fluctuations, especially in testosterone levels, can influence mood, leading to irritability, mood swings, or even depression.

  • Insomnia or Poor Sleep Quality:

Hormonal imbalances may disrupt sleep patterns, causing difficulty falling asleep or maintaining restful sleep.

  • Thinning Hair or Balding:

Changes in testosterone levels can contribute to hair loss.

  • Reduced Muscle Mass:

Testosterone is crucial for maintaining muscle mass, and a hormonal imbalance may result in a decline in muscle size and strength.

  • Sudden Temperature Changes:

While hot flashes are more commonly associated with menopause in women, hormonal imbalances in men can also lead to sudden temperature changes and sweating.

  • Gynecomastia:

An imbalance in estrogen and testosterone levels may cause the development of breast tissue in men, a condition known as gynecomastia.

  • Osteoporosis or Bone Fractures:

Low testosterone levels can lead to a reduction in bone density, potentially leading to osteoporosis and an increased risk of bone fractures.

  • Cognitive Impairment:

Hormonal imbalances may impact cognitive function, leading to memory problems, difficulty concentrating, or brain fog.
